What is computer engineering?

*Understanding Computer Engineering: A Comprehensive Guide*


Computer engineering is a dynamic field at the intersection of computer science and electrical engineering. It encompasses the design, development, and maintenance of hardware and software components of computing systems. From microprocessors in smartphones to large-scale data centers powering cloud services, computer engineers play a crucial role in shaping the technological landscape of today and tomorrow.


### *Foundations of Computer Engineering*


*1. Hardware Basics:*

   Computer hardware refers to the physical components that make up a computer system. This includes processors (CPUs), memory modules (RAM), storage devices (hard drives, SSDs), motherboards, and peripheral devices such as keyboards, mice, and monitors. Understanding hardware architecture involves knowledge of digital logic, integrated circuits (ICs), and electronic components.


*2. Software Fundamentals:*

   Software comprises programs and applications that enable users to perform tasks on a computer. Computer engineers are involved in software development, which ranges from low-level firmware embedded in hardware devices to high-level applications and operating systems (OS). Key programming languages include C, C++, Java, Python, and assembly language for low-level programming.


### *Key Concepts in Computer Engineering*


*1. Digital Systems:*

   Digital systems are built using binary logic, where data is represented as sequences of 0s and 1s. Boolean algebra forms the basis for designing and analyzing digital circuits, which are fundamental to modern computing devices.


*2. Computer Architecture:*

   Computer architecture defines the structure and behavior of a computer system. It includes the design of processors, memory systems, input/output (I/O) interfaces, and the overall organization of components to optimize performance, power consumption, and scalability.


*3. Networks and Communication:*

   Networking is essential for connecting computers and enabling data exchange between devices. Computer engineers design network protocols, routers, switches, and wireless communication technologies to support local area networks (LANs), wide area networks (WANs), and the internet.


*4. Embedded Systems:*

   Embedded systems are specialized computing systems designed to perform specific functions within larger devices or systems. Examples include microcontrollers in consumer electronics, automotive systems, industrial machinery, and medical devices.


### *Career Opportunities*


Computer engineering offers diverse career paths across industries such as telecommunications, automotive, healthcare, aerospace, and finance. Roles include:


- *Hardware Engineer:* Designing and testing computer components.

- *Software Developer:* Writing code for applications and systems software.

- *Network Engineer:* Managing and optimizing network infrastructure.

- *Embedded Systems Engineer:* Developing firmware for embedded devices.

- *Systems Architect:* Designing and integrating complex computing systems.


### *Educational Pathways*


A typical educational path in computer engineering includes a bachelor’s degree in computer engineering, electrical engineering, or a related field. Advanced degrees (master’s or Ph.D.) can lead to specialized research or managerial positions.


### *Emerging Trends*


- *Artificial Intelligence (AI) and Machine Learning:* Integrating AI algorithms into hardware and software systems.

- *Internet of Things (IoT):* Connecting everyday devices to the internet for data exchange and automation.

- *Cybersecurity:* Protecting systems from malicious attacks and ensuring data privacy.
